Why It Matters
Michelin Key holder. Arthur Casas architecture. Every room has a different curated art selection by Guilherme Wisnik. Charlô Whately — a São Paulo culinary name — runs all food and beverage. Rooms use Alexa for automation and feature pieces by Brazilian design icons Jorge Zalszupin, Sergio Rodrigues, and Percival Lafer. Part of Preferred Hotels & Resorts LVX collection.
Pulso opened quietly in March 2024 on a side street off Faria Lima Avenue, and it's already the most compelling new hotel in São Paulo. Architect Arthur Casas designed a building that reads like Brazilian modernism distilled — a brise-soleil facade of wood-toned slats, a lobby anchored by a 30-meter Nuno Ramos artwork running along the indoor garden, and rooms furnished with vintage pieces Casas personally sourced from the Bixiga antique market. The culinary lineup (Charlô Bistrô, Sarau Bar, Cha Cha Boulangerie) is genuinely good rather than hotel-grade good, and the wellness floor — heated pool, Technogym gym, Pulso Spa by L'Occitane — is properly thought through.

The hotel houses a curated collection of Brazilian contemporary art assembled by São Paulo critic and architect Guilherme Wisnik. Works are distributed across every room and common area. The lobby installation 'Mácula' by Nuno Ramos runs 30 meters along the indoor garden with large-scale Braille inscriptions. No formal tour — the art is simply present throughout the property.
Thursday to Saturday evenings, DJ and sound researcher Victor Kurc brings São Paulo's nightlife scene into the bar. Open to hotel guests and the public.
Every Tuesday evening at Sarau Bar, Estúdio Pulso presents live Brazilian music performances curated by musician and cultural figure Rômulo Fróes. Past artists have included Vanessa Moreno, Sophia Chablau, Bruna Alimonda, and Bruna Caram. Ticketed event open to non-guests.
Meeting rooms adaptable for small corporate gatherings and private events. The hotel also handles private dining and event hire at the Sarau Bar.
A Technogym-equipped gym on the wellness floor. Open 24 hours for guests. On weekdays, a sports advisor is available for guidance. City views from the equipment floor.
Covered and heated pool on the wellness floor, set in a window-lined room that appears to float above the central garden. Food, beverage, and towel service available poolside. Pool is heated year-round.
